Analyst firm Gartner has changed its stance on reviewers using Generative AI for Peer Insights – provided you do it their way.

The controlled use of Gen AI starts with suggestions for a review headline – something many reviewers struggle with. An AI-based spellchecker also offers assistance.

With the service in beta, Gartner says it already helped users correct 180,000 typos. That’s a good thing, for sure – but Gartner must guard against a proliferation of blander, AI-generated headlines.
